Understanding the Mechanics of the Chicken Road

The “chicken road” concept builds on the foundation of popular ‘gamble’ features found in many online slots. Instead of simply guessing colors or playing card games, players actively control the progression of a character – in this case, a chicken – along a winding path. With each step the chicken takes, the multiplier associated with the initial winning amount increases. The goal is to “cash out” at the highest possible multiplier before the chicken encounters a game-ending obstacle.

These obstacles can vary widely depending on the game provider. Common hazards include foxes, dogs, or other predators that instantly halt the chicken’s journey and forfeit any accumulated winnings. The tension lies in the dilemma of whether to continue seeking a larger multiplier, risking a complete loss, or to secure a profit before misfortune strikes. This element of control, combined with the inherent uncertainty, distinguishes the chicken road from simpler gamble features.

Understanding Variance and RTP

Return to Player (RTP) represents the percentage of wagered money that a slot game theoretically returns to players over a long period. A higher RTP implies a better chance of recouping your bets over time, but doesn’t guarantee short-term wins. Variance, or volatility, describes the level of risk associated with a game. High-variance slots feature infrequent but substantial payouts, while low-variance slots offer more frequent, smaller wins. When approaching the chicken road, it’s important to align your strategy with the game’s RTP and volatility. For instance, if you’re playing a high-variance game, you might be more inclined to aim for larger multipliers, accepting the higher risk. Conversely, a low-variance game might encourage more cautious play and earlier cash-outs.
